The Importance of Renewable Energy in Rural Areas

Renewable energy sources, such as solar, wind, and hydropower, offer a viable and sustainable solution for rural electrification. Here are the key reasons why renewable energy is of utmost importance in revitalizing rural areas:

  • Environmental sustainability: Renewable energy sources do not deplete natural resources or contribute to greenhouse gas emissions, making them a clean and sustainable choice for electrification in rural areas. This helps in preserving the environment and mitigating climate change.
  • Reduced dependency on fossil fuels: Rural areas often rely on expensive and unreliable diesel generators or kerosene lamps for electricity. Introducing renewable energy systems reduces their dependency on fossil fuels, thereby ensuring a stable and cost-effective energy supply.
  • Energy independence: Implementing renewable energy systems in rural areas provides them with a decentralized and self-sufficient energy source. This reduces vulnerability to disruptions in the central grid and empowers communities to manage their own energy needs.
  • Job creation and economic growth: Renewable energy projects in rural areas create employment opportunities locally, stimulating economic development and inclusive growth. This can help combat unemployment and drive rural prosperity.
  • Improved access to education and healthcare: Electricity is fundamental to improving access to education and healthcare services. Renewable energy can power schools, hospitals, and community centers, enhancing the overall quality of life in rural areas.

Key Advantages of Renewable Energy in Rural Electrification

1. Cost-effectiveness:

Renewable energy technologies have witnessed significant cost reductions in recent years. This makes them an affordable option for rural electrification, especially when compared to the expenses associated with extending the central grid to remote areas. By harnessing abundant natural resources, such as sunlight and wind, rural communities can generate electricity at a lower cost and achieve long-term financial savings.

2. Scalability:

Renewable energy projects can be scaled to suit the specific energy needs of rural areas. From small-scale solar home systems to community-level microgrids, these solutions can cater to various energy demands. This flexibility allows for incremental expansion and adaptation based on the growth and development of the community. It also enables tailored energy solutions that align with local requirements and resources.

3. Technological advancements:

Continuous advancements in renewable energy technologies ensure greater efficiency and reliability. Innovations in energy storage systems, smart grids, and miniaturized equipment facilitate the integration and management of renewable energy sources. These technological developments further enhance the feasibility and performance of renewable energy solutions in rural areas.

4. Environmental benefits:

Renewable energy significantly reduces carbon emissions compared to traditional fossil fuel-based electricity generation. Implementing renewable energy systems in rural areas helps combat air pollution and mitigates climate change. It also minimizes the ecological impact of energy production, preserving the flora and fauna of rural regions.
